Quick note for the sync: if TrailTally's offline mode starts dropping survey batches after reconnect, don't just restart the sync daemon — check the conflict queue first, since a stuck merge blocks everything behind it. If the queue is over 200 entries or growing, escalate to the field-apps on-call rather than fighting it yourself. Past incidents (see the Marlow Ridge outage writeup) always traced back to clock skew on devices. Escalations go to the mobile platform lead.

alerts address for kajog-tadup: druox@plorvanet.internal

The linter walks every changed page on each merge request, and wall-clock time scales roughly linearly with page count but spikes when cross-reference resolution kicks in. We cap concurrent lint jobs to keep the shared runner pool responsive, and oversized pages are chunked rather than rejected, which trades memory for predictable latency. Reviewer: please confirm the chunk size and concurrency values against the runner pool's measured headroom before approving. The proposed constants are set out below.

constants for tageg-kagag:
QUOTAS = {
    "kelax": 495,
    "istath": 366,
    "tammir": 108,
    "novdor": 730,
    "casax": 816,
    "quenael": 874,
    "pelius": 403,
}

CI troubleshooting — Keyturner rotation utility. If the rotation job fails at the vault-handshake stage, first confirm the runner picked up the refreshed lease rather than a cached one; stale leases produce a misleading permissions error. Re-queue once before escalating, and capture the runner's environment dump. When filing the ticket, attach the build token printed below for correlation.

session token of bawep-yadup = htk21_528abd376e3c5a4ec24a1

# Hermetic build migration — note for the release manager
#
# As of sprint 41 the Larkspur pipeline builds under Bastion, our hermetic
# build system, instead of the legacy hostside toolchain. All network
# fetches are now proxied through the Quillcache artifact mirror, so any
# dependency not pinned in the manifest will fail the build on purpose.
# The client below talks to the Bastion orchestration API to request
# sandboxed workers and report provenance. It authenticates with the
# credential that follows on the next line.

API key for yahig-tadup: kto7_ubizbYm